As a city, Chiang Mai is constantly evolving as a food Mecca in Northern Thailand and is famous for its Lanna Food (Northern Thai). Included in this video:

Traditional Northern Thai food (Lanna Food):

• Sai Oua Northern Style Sausage aka Chiang Mai Sausage
• Khao Soi ‘split rice’ Curry Noodle Soup,
• Khanom Jeen Nam Ngiao Northern Noodle Soup (aka Thai Spagbol),
• Nam Prik Noom and Nam Prik Ong: Northern Thai chilli dips
• Kap Moo and Kap Kai: Crispy Pork Rinds and Chicken Skins
